Cuemon .NET Framework
EntityMapper Class Members
Properties  Methods 


The following tables list the members exposed by EntityMapper.

Public Constructors
 NameDescription
Public ConstructorEntityMapper ConstructorOverloaded.   
Top
Public Properties
 NameDescription
Public PropertySourceGets the Entity of this instance.  
Public PropertySourceTypeGets the specific System.Type of the Entity of this instance.  
Top
Public Methods
 NameDescription
Public MethodGetInheritanceChainGets the inheritance chain of the SourceType.  
Public MethodParseDeleteStatementParses the delete statement of an Entity.  
Public MethodParseDemoteStatementParses the delete statement of a demoted Entity.  
Public MethodParseInsertStatementParses the insert statement of an Entity.  
Public MethodParsePromoteStatementParses the insert statement of a promoted Entity.  
Public MethodParseSelectExistsStatementParses the select statement for looking up an Entity.  
Public MethodParseSelectManyStatement<T>Parses the select statement for the sequence of an Entity.  
Public MethodParseSelectStatementParses the select statement of an Entity.  
Public MethodParseUpdateStatementParses the update statement of an Entity.  
Top
Protected Methods
 NameDescription
Protected MethodGetDataParametersGets the data parameters necessary for data mapping.  
Protected MethodGetDataParametersForObjectRankingGets the data parameters necessary for data mapping when either promoting or demoting an object.  
Protected MethodGetStorageFieldsOverloaded. Gets the storage fields from the specified entityType.  
Protected MethodGetStorageTypeOverloaded. Gets the System.Type of a private storage field from the provided class type.  
Protected MethodGetStorageValueOverloaded. Gets the value of a private storage field from the provided class type.  
Protected Methodstatic (Shared in Visual Basic)ParseEntityTypeForOpenListParse and resolve the System.Type to fill a BusinessEntityCollection<T> with.  
Protected MethodSetStorageValueSets the given value in a private storage field in the provided class type.  
Top
See Also

Reference

EntityMapper Class
Cuemon.Data.Entity Namespace

 

 


| Cuemon is licensed under a The MIT License (MIT)



© 2009-2015 Weubphoria. All Rights Reserved.

Documentation made easy with Document! X by Innovasys

Send Feedback